Possible ‘One-Year Fix’ For PA Budget Could Endanger Short-Term Prospects For Online Gambling by Dustin Gouker

The progress of a gaming package in PA — one that would also legalize online gambling and daily fantasy sports — has stalled during a stalemate over how to pay for the state budget. The House and Senate have been at odds in trying to raise nearly $2 billion in new revenue.

The Senate passed an overarching revenue package in July that included $200 million from a gaming package. But the House has not acted.
